What is PupilPath?
Pupil Path is a student information system for parents and students. Pupil Path allows parents and students to view important student and school information such as student attendance records, class schedule, assignment due dates and grades, graduation eligibility, school announcements, and more.

New to PupilPath
First, you must register on Pupil Path. You will be receiving or have already received a Pupil Path invitation letter from your school. This letter will provide you with your student’s OSIS (ID) number and the registration code you need in order to sign up.
Assignments Tab or Assignments Shortcut on Homepage
This tab displays your child’s assignments and grades on those assignments. Choose from the All Assignments view, the Upcoming Assignments View (NEW) and the Graded Assignments view (NEW)
Grades Tab or Grades Shortcut on Homepage
This tab displays your grades, past and present. Choose from Class Performance view (NEW), Report Card view, Transcript view, or Exam view.
Attendance Tab or Attendance Shortcut on Homepage
This tab displays your child’s Daily attendance history and Course attendance history.
Calendar Tab
This tab displays your child’s daily attendance history as well as class attendance for any class where the teacher is using the online attendance function. PROGRESS TAB This tab compares your child’s earned credits against the school Tracking and the New York State Graduation requirements.

If your school is currently using PupilPath as their parent and student portal, the PupilPath mobile application allows parents, teachers, and students to have instant access to student information on the go, including: - Notifications when a grade is submitted, or when a student is marked absent/late - Recent Notifications view - Up-to-date classroom progress - Attendance live as it is taken - Grades and status of assignments and exams - Assignment due dates and descriptions - Student GPA and averages in grading categories - Report card grades - Student transcripts - Student schedules - Mail **REQUIREMENTS Your school must be using the Skedula and PupilPath platforms to use this app.
